arp报文发送的描述_第1页
arp报文发送的描述_第2页
arp报文发送的描述_第3页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

arp报文发送的描述一、ARP报文概述1.ARP报文定义a.ARP(AddressResolutionProtocol)报文是用于在局域网中实现IP地址到MAC地址转换的协议。b.ARP报文在以太网、令牌环等局域网中广泛应用。c.ARP报文通过广播方式发送,由发送方发起,接收方响应。2.ARP报文结构a.ARP报文包含硬件类型、协议类型、硬件地址长度、协议地址长度、操作码、发送方硬件地址、发送方协议地址、接收方硬件地址、接收方协议地址等字段。b.硬件类型和协议类型字段用于标识硬件和协议类型。c.操作码字段用于标识ARP报文类型,如请求、响应等。3.ARP报文工作原理a.当发送方需要与某个设备通信时,检查本地ARP缓存中是否存在该设备的MAC地址。b.如果存在,则直接使用该MAC地址进行通信;如果不存在,则发送ARP请求报文。c.接收方收到ARP请求报文后,根据报文中的IP地址查找对应的MAC地址,并将该信息发送给发送方。d.发送方收到ARP响应报文后,将获取到的MAC地址存储到本地ARP缓存中,以便下次通信时直接使用。二、ARP报文发送过程1.发送ARP请求报文a.发送方检查本地ARP缓存,看是否存在目标设备的MAC地址。a.如果存在,则直接使用该MAC地址进行通信;如果不存在,则发送ARP请求报文。b.发送方将目标设备的IP地址填入ARP请求报文的接收方协议地址字段。c.发送方将本机的MAC地址和IP地址分别填入ARP请求报文的发送方硬件地址和发送方协议地址字段。d.发送方将目标设备的硬件地址和协议地址字段置为全零。2.接收ARP请求报文a.当接收方收到ARP请求报文时,检查报文中的目标IP地址是否与自己的IP地址相同。b.如果相同,则表示该ARP请求报文是针对自己的,接收方需要响应该请求。c.接收方将本机的MAC地址和IP地址分别填入ARP响应报文的发送方硬件地址和发送方协议地址字段。d.接收方将目标设备的硬件地址和协议地址字段置为全零。3.发送ARP响应报文a.接收方将ARP响应报文发送给发送方。b.发送方收到ARP响应报文后,将获取到的MAC地址存储到本地ARP缓存中。c.发送方使用获取到的MAC地址进行后续通信。三、ARP报文发送注意事项1.ARP缓存更新a.当ARP缓存中的MAC地址与实际设备不匹配时,需要及时更新ARP缓存。b.更新ARP缓存可以通过发送ARP请求报文或直接修改本地ARP缓存实现。c.定期清理ARP缓存,避免缓存过时。2.ARP欺骗攻击防范a.ARP欺骗攻击是指攻击者通过伪造ARP响应报文,使目标设备与攻击者指定的MAC地址进行通信。①使用静态ARP绑定,将设备的IP地址和MAC地址进行绑定,防止ARP欺骗。②使用ARP防火墙,检测并阻止ARP欺骗攻击。③定期检查网络设备,确保设备配置正确。3.ARP协议优化a.ARP协议存在一些局限性,如广播风暴、ARP缓存失效等问题。①使用多播技术,减少ARP请求的广播范围。②使用动态ARP代理,减少ARP请求的发送次数。③使用ARP缓存持久化,延长ARP缓存的有效期。1.陈文光.计算机网络[M].北京:清华大学出版

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论